Evaluating ETF Performance
When comparing ETFs to BRK.B, it's essential to consider return on investment (ROI), risk, sector focus, and expense ratios. Some ETFs have demonstrated outstanding results over certain periods, owing to various factors like technological innovation or global market shifts. Here’s a look at a few that have gained notable investor attention:
1. QQQ - Invesco QQQ Trust
The Invesco QQQ Trust, which tracks the Nasdaq-100 Index, is a favorite for those seeking exposure to tech giants like Apple, Microsoft, and Amazon. Strong growth in the tech sector often results in high returns, sometimes surpassing BRK.B, especially in bullish market cycles. However, it's worth noting that this ETF can be more volatile compared to Berkshire's holdings.
2. SPY - SPDR S&P 500 ETF Trust
Tracking the S&P 500, this ETF offers a diversified portfolio encompassing various sectors. Historically, the SPY has provided competitive returns and might outperform more concentrated investments like BRK.B during certain market expansions.
3. VUG - Vanguard Growth ETF
For investors focusing on growth stocks, VUG provides exposure to U.S. companies with high growth potential. It's known for its significant gains in bull markets, occasionally outpacing BRK.B. However, as with any growth-focused investment, there's inherent risk involved.
4. ARKK - ARK Innovation ETF
While more volatile, ARKK, managed by Cathie Wood, focuses on disruptive innovation. During years of rapid technological advances, this ETF has occasionally yielded high returns, potentially outperforming BRK.B. Investors should be comfortable with significant price swings to consider this ETF.
